https://thebanter.substack.com/p/its-not-just-trumpers-spreading-proWASHINGTON, DC -- Last week, we learned about one of the most terrifying political operations in recent memory. Journalist McKay Coppins published an article for The Atlantic about Donald Trumps Death Star in Rosslyn, Virginia -- an office space in which Trumps campaign manager, Brad Parscale, along with a staff of hundreds, is engaged in "the most extensive disinformation campaign in U.S. history."
The mission of Trumps Death Star is to micro-target registered voters on social media with countless political advertisements and other posts designed to spread pro-Trump propaganda, in most cases straight-up lies. All in all, the operation effectively weaponizes the Russian Internet Research Agencys attack on the 2016 election, but originating the same brand of awfulness domestically and under the full control of the Trump machine.
We also learned that the Republican National Committee, which has merged with the Trump campaign, possesses around 3,000 data points on every American voter. Thats you. Thats me. Thats every living American whos registered. These data points include your biases, your flaws, your preferences -- everything that might be pulled from your social media presence, and which Mark Zuckerberg allowed to be harvested without our permission. And speaking of Zuckerberg, the Facebook founder decided after meeting with Trump that itd be fine and dandy to continue allowing on the platform political ads that contain lies.
The idea is to manipulate voters into willingly circulating the pro-Trump, anti-Democratic lies without flinching, turning Facebook users into distributors of free media -- of lies and propaganda.
